Car crashes into mosque compound, goes soaring in air
Team Udayavani, Oct 22, 2019, 3:12 PM IST
Mangaluru: In a shocking incident a Maruti Omni car went soaring in the air before crashing down after ramming into the compound wall of a mosque at Farangipet here on Tuesday, October 22 afternoon. Five persons sustained injuries in the accident.
A CCTV footage of the accident shows the car, belonging to Prasad Eye Care hospital moving towards Mangaluru from BC Road when the driver rammed into the Tahwa Juma mosque compound wall went soaring into the air and crashed at the other end of the mosque compound.
Two of the injured identified as Ismail and Sulaiman were present in the Masjid campus at the time of the mishap. The identity of three others – occupants of the car, including the driver is yet to be ascertained. The injured were rushed to a nearby hospital for treatment.
Police visited the spot and are investigating the case.
